Driveway Sealing in Tampa, FL
Driveway sealing services involve applying a protective coating to the surface of a driveway to help preserve its condition and appearance. This process is suitable for various types of driveways, including asphalt, concrete, and gravel, and helps prevent damage from weather, UV rays, oil spills, and everyday wear and tear. Homeowners often request driveway sealing to extend the lifespan of their driveway, improve curb appeal, and reduce the need for costly repairs in the future. Before requesting sealing services, property owners typically want to understand the condition of their driveway surface, the recommended timing for sealing, and the type of sealant best suited for their specific driveway material.
Property owners should consider whether their driveway is free of cracks, potholes, or other damage before sealing, as these issues might need to be addressed separately. It is also helpful to know that sealing is most effective when the driveway is clean and dry, usually after cleaning or power washing. Additionally, understanding the different sealant options and their durability can aid in selecting the right service to meet their needs. Proper preparation and choosing the appropriate sealing product can contribute to a longer-lasting, more attractive driveway.

Driveway Sealing Questions
What is driveway sealing? Driveway sealing involves applying a protective coating to asphalt surfaces to help prevent damage from weather, oil, and traffic.
Why should homeowners consider driveway sealing? Sealing can extend the lifespan of a driveway, improve its appearance, and help resist cracks and deterioration.
How often should a driveway be sealed? Typically, sealing is recommended every 2 to 3 years to maintain protection and appearance.
What types of driveways can benefit from sealing? Both residential and commercial asphalt driveways can benefit from sealing to preserve their condition and appearance.
